As the IJB Chief Officer and Director of Health and Social Care, you will be responsible for providing high-level strategic leadership to address the complex opportunities and challenges faced across health and social care. This includes tackling growing demand, improving recruitment and workforce retention, and driving the implementation of innovative practices and advancements in technology.
You will manage an annual budget of approximately £248M, with overarching responsibility for strategic planning, commissioning, and ensuring the effective delivery of services in alignment with the Integration Joint Board Strategic Plan 2021-31. Your role will involve working closely with stakeholders to promote the integration of health and social care services, ensuring they are responsive, sustainable, and future-focused.
This position requires an exceptional, politically astute leader with a proven track record of sustained success at a senior level. The ideal candidate will have demonstrated expertise in driving meaningful change, fostering a culture of continuous improvement, and establishing high-performing teams. Your ability to navigate complex political landscapes while delivering tangible results and achieving organisational goals will be crucial to the success of this role.
Under the Local Government and Housing Act 1989 this post is politically restricted.

The Partnership is governed by the Integration Joint Board (IJB), which consists of eight voting members appointed by South Ayrshire Council and NHS Ayrshire and Arran. The Board also includes representatives from a range of sectors, including the third sector, independent sector, staff representatives, and individuals who represent the interests of patients, service users, carers, and professionals.
The Partnership delivers a wide range of operational services across various local settings, including social work offices, health centres, GP practices, community hospitals, care homes, intermediate care facilities, day centres, and schools. This comprehensive network ensures the provision of integrated and accessible services tailored to the diverse needs of the community.

This is a full-time, permanent position. Reflecting the joint nature of this appointment, the successful candidate will have the option of being appointed on the terms and conditions of either NHS Ayrshire and Arran or South Ayrshire Council, including salary.
For South Ayrshire Council terms and conditions - the Grade of this post is Chief Officer 50 and the annual salary is £143,702.
For NHS terms and conditions - the Grade of this post is ESM F and the annual salary is from £106,955 to £141,596 based on a 37.5 hour working week.
